Redwood is currently looking for a Management Specialist to join our talented team and positively impact our organization.

Under the general direction of the Regional Neighborhood Manager, the Management Specialist will be responsible for supporting new and current neighborhood managers and working in interim positions as needed. Supports all facets of assigned temporary apartment neighborhood including managing resident relations, collecting rent, scheduling and supervising apartment turnovers, approving rental applications, marketing, and compiling and generating reports needed by the Corporate Office. They shall conduct all organizational business and practices in accordance with Redwood Living, Inc. policies.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Fill in at sites with Neighborhood Manager vacancies.
  • Onboard and support new Neighborhood Managers regarding policies and procedures.
  • Provide training support to Neighborhood Managers and Multi-Site Leasing Professionals as needed.
  • Perform site audits under the direction of the Regional Neighborhood Manager and Director of Property Operations.
  • Greeting prospective residents, showing the model/neighborhood, and answering questions.
  • Answering phones/emails on a daily basis.
  • Compliance with all legal and financial leasing/resident arrangements.
  • Ability to create sales strategies and close.
  • Performing administrative tasks such as bank deposits/reconciliations, property reporting, evictions, correspondences, etc.
  • Proactive property management regarding safety and maintenance objectives.
  • Full utilization of technical systems to provides up-to-date property activities, financial transactions, and reporting.
  • Adherence to company standards for paperwork, resident files, budgets and controlled expenses.
  • All other related duties and special project involvement as assigned.
